                                            @Testament there are sooo many reasons for people to respond to scenes in things other than the order in which they were updated. I’m about to do it this morning.

                                            • A lot of times, if I know someone is “around” for a bit, I’ll put my focus on that scene so we can make some progress.

                                            • There’s also “this is is fluff, easy pose” vs “this scene needs real brains.”

                                            • Sometimes, I read a pose and immediately know my response so I write it while it’s hot, and that can often help me get ideas in other scenes, so I circle back to those.

                                            • Now and then, I just need to finish this gd scene and will focus on it to get it done!!

                                            • Some scenes just GET GOOD, and I pay attention to them more. It’s not that my other scenes are bad, but I may be more invested in some than others. This is as close as I can say it comes to making it “about” my scene partners, but even then… so much goes into why a scene gets GOOD - timing, chemistry, rng failing dice, etc.

                                            • On Monday, I was going between a bunch of devices and missed a pose for like FOUR HOURS in one scene. I was all posing at other scenes (lol including one with you i think) all morning before I realized I missed it. This is not an isolated incident.

                                            It’s real easy to take it personally. I definitely have been like “wtf where my pose at!!” when trolling active scenes. But it probably has nothing to do with YOU.
